Am super excited about this update!. Well, I know majority if people will continue to complain that they need more... To me, these anticipated features alone made my day:
  • Finally separate independent Bluetooth connectivity for rear screen (great for kids, I'll get a Bluetooth speaker installed so then can listen without needing headphones but still play their stuff independently from music in the car.
  • High Fidelity Park Assist 3D visualization --> I saw some leaked twitter photos, I actually liked it and it makes the lack of 360 bird view vision less of an issue
  • Play favorite games on the rear touchscreen becomes available with joystick connectivity too. Awesome for road trips while spouse is driving : ) why not, and good for kids too.
